    11 12 2019 2019 “Don't stay put.pngBHMSS Biblical Passage for the day – 2 Corinthians 4:18 (AMP) – So we look not at the things which are seen, but at the things which are unseen; for the things which are visible are temporal [just brief and fleeting], but the things which are invisible are everlasting and imperishable.

     
    Praise the Lord Beloved. Happy Tuesday to you. 😀
     
    Beloved, don’t centralize your focus on what you can instinctively see and recognize in this world. Everything you see is temporal and subject to modification. Put your trust, belief, and confidence in the unseen eternal realm. The things which are eternal aren’t subject to transformation.
     
    The Word of God is eternal, and it contains many pledges that cover any situation you’ll ever face. No matter what happens in this unstable, fluctuating world you live in, those pledges will forever be the same.
     
    Regardless of how you’re feeling, the Word will always say, “By His stripes, you were healed” (*1). No matter how bad your bank account looks, the Word will always say, “My God shall supply all your need according to his riches in glory by Christ Jesus” (*2).
     
    Don’t stay put or do things because the world says you have to or believe what the world says you can and cannot have. Lay hold of what the Word says you can do and can have. Center your devotion on the eternal truths of God and look not to the things which are seen. After all, they’re subject to modification!!! Amen? Aaamen. ✝️❤️😊

    Praise the Lord Beloved – let us thank God for allowing us to start another Friday under His covenant.

    You know Beloved, sooner or later your faith will be tested, no matter how durable or how frail it is. It may be tested by an unconvinced employer, or maybe more likely it’ll be tested by the trials of life. Beloved, eventually something happens, and your heart will cry out, “Not again Lord, I just cannot handle this.” It may be a parent, child, relative or friend’s illness or death, or a marriage/relationship that turns bitter, or a business deal which has not gone well.

    It’s happened to me on several occasions from divorce, lost court case to the loss of a child, relative and friends. I’ve found myself asking God “WHY?” and God You said You would not put no more on me than I can handle, but this one is tough “Lord, I just can’t handle this.”. Many will run away or get upset with God. Beloved, when there’s something which you can’t handle turning and running away or shaking your fist in the face of God is not the solution. When the foundation of your faith is shaken, I encourage you to go first to the Word of God and take refuge in the Bible. There are dozens of promises with your name attached to them. In the Word you’ll begin to see life from His viewpoint. You’ll begin to think God’s thoughts. You’ll understand 2 Corinthians 4:18 – “what’s seen is temporary, but what’s unseen is eternal”. Beloved, when your faith is tested take a look at the situations, and then look at the situations of individuals in the Bible. Match up their problem with yours and notice how God met them.

    Today my life, mind and emotions lean heavily on the Written Word of God. So, as you start your Friday and go into the weekend remind yourself of the truth of God’s Word and that He is honor bound to keep His Word. Years ago Apostle Paul wrote (2 Timothy 1:12 AMP) “for I know Him [and I am personally acquainted with Him] whom I have believed [with absolute trust and confidence… that He is able to guard that which I have entrusted to Him until that day [when I stand before Him].”

    Beloved, “a faith not tested means a spiritual life that’s congested.” (Bishop, W. F. Houston, Jr.)
